Frequently asked questions
How far is AGU from VXO?
The flight distance from Aguascalientes (AGU) to Vaxjo (VXO) is 5,904 miles (9,501 km, 5,130 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.
How long is the flight from AGU to VXO?
A nonstop flight takes about 12h 3m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
What is the time difference between Aguascalientes and Vaxjo?
Vaxjo is 8 hours ahead of Aguascalientes.
